Does anyone know anything about Andrew's newest release, "Mayhem"? It looks like there may be some interesting stuff in there such as -
PAPER CUT: Tear off a piece of paper and slice it into your arm. THUMBTACK: Turn innocent office supplies into an amazing demonstration of pain control. SCISSORS: A shock effect that can be presented on a moment's notice. SNEEZE: Blow your nose and make a brick appear. If anyone has this, please share your opinions. Also, the descriptions of some of the tricks are a bit vague and I would like to know what some of them actually are. |
